PTO Gears
Gears associated with the Power Take-Off system, which allows auxiliary equipment to draw power from a vehicle's engine.
Mainshaft Washers
Washers placed on the mainshaft of a gearbox or transmission system to ensure proper spacing and prevent metal-to-metal contact.
Low Oil Level
A condition indicating that the volume of oil in a system, such as an engine, is below the recommended threshold, potentially leading to damage or failure.
Improper Towing
The act of towing a vehicle or object in a manner that is unsafe or does not comply with legal and manufacturer guidelines, risking damage or accidents.
